            "text": "The 350 cities around the world which currently make up this network work together towards a common objective: placing creativity and cultural industries at the heart of their development plans at the local level and cooperating actively at the international level.\n\nBy joining the Network, cities acknowledge their commitment to sharing best practices, developing partnerships that promote creativity and the cultural industries, strengthening participation in cultural life and integrating culture in urban development plans. The Network further commits to supporting the United Nations frameworks, particularly the 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development. The UNESCO Creative Cities Network covers seven creative fields: Architecture, Crafts and Folk Art, Design, Film, Gastronomy, Literature, Media Arts, and Music.",

            "text": "The cryosphere, including glaciers, ice sheets, permafrost, sea ice and snow, stores around 70% of Earth’s freshwater, yet it is shrinking fast. Glaciers are losing mass every year; Arctic sea ice has declined by about 40% since 1979; and the Greenland and Antarctic ice sheets are melting at accelerating rates, with long-term implications for sea level rise. Cryosphere loss already affects water security, ecosystems, infrastructure and disaster risk worldwide. \r\n\r\nIn response, the United Nations designated 21 March as World Day for Glaciers and proclaimed 2025 as the International Year of Glaciers’ Preservation (IYGP 2025), led by UNESCO and World Meteorological Organization. The UN also declared 2025–2034 the Decade of Action for Cryospheric Sciences, led by UNESCO, to strengthen research, monitoring, education and policy action on cryospheric change. In addition, 22 March 2026 marks World Water Day, with a focus on water, women and gender equality.",

            "about": "UNESCO is warning that 90% of the planet's land surface could be degraded by 2050, with major risks for biodiversity and human life.",
            "text": "At an international conference in Agadir (Morocco), Audrey Azoulay, Director-General of UNESCO, appealed to the Organization's 194 Member States to improve soil protection and rehabilitation. UNESCO is also undertaking a number of actions to fill the scientific knowledge gaps in this field.\nHealthy soils are essential for maintaining ecosystems and biodiversity, regulating the climate, producing food and purifying water. However, according to the World Atlas of Desertification, 75% of them are already degraded, directly impacting 3.2 billion people. And if current trends continue, this proportion will rise to 90% by 2050. \nThe Conference discussions have led to an action plan based on 3 key objectives: improving soil protection and rehabilitation, filling the scientific knowledge gaps in this field, and strengthening the commitment of young people and communities through education and training programmes.",

            "text": "Mangroves act as natural buffers against storms, protect coastlines, preserve biodiversity, prevent erosion, sequester carbon, maintain water quality, and support local livelihoods. On Providencia, mangroves shielded communities during Hurricane Iota. \r\n\r\nThe Mangrove Restoration project by the United Nations Organization is restoring mangrove ecosystems in Providencia Island and seven Latin American and Caribbean countries, including Colombia, Cuba, Ecuador, El Salvador, Mexico, Panama, and Peru. The project combines scientific methods with traditional knowledge, involving communities in restoration, monitoring, and education. By creating a replicable model, the initiative strengthens ecological resilience, protects cultural heritage, and promotes sustainable management of these essential ecosystems.",

            "about": "In September 2024, the UNESCO Global Geoparks Council proposed 15 new geoparks for endorsement. Should UNESCO’s Executive Board endorse this decision when it meets next year, this would expand the network to 228 sites around the world.",
            "text": "In order to be considered for the UNESCO Global Geopark label, the territory must have been in operating as a de facto geopark for at least one year. The 12 members of the UNESCO Global Geoparks Council examined 21 candidates at the Council’s ninth session on 8–9 September, held in Non Nuoc Cao Bang UNESCO Global Geopark in Viet Nam. Of these, the Council endorsed the following 15 prospective UNESCO Global Geoparks: \n- China: Kanbula\n- China: Yunyang\n- Ecuador: Napo Sumaco \n- Ecuador: Tungurahua Volcano \n- Indonesia: Kebumen\n- Indonesia: Meratus\n- Italy: MurGeopark\n- Norway: Fjord Coast Regional and Geopark\n- Republic of Korea: Danyang\n- Republic of Korea: Gyeongbuk Donghaean\n- Saudi Arabia: North Riyadh\n- Saudi Arabia: Salma\n- Spain: Costa Quebrada\n- United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land: Arran\n- Viet Nam: Lang Son.\n\nBesides, the Council deferred 3 applications:\n- Canada: Niagara\n- Mexico: Múzquiz Coahuila\n- Morocco: Chefchaouen.",
